The Right to Review Information.
Pursuant to the Protection of Privacy Law, every individual is entitled, either personally or by their representative appointed by them in writing or by their legal guardian, to review any information about them which is stored in the Database. An individual who has reviewed such information and found it to be inaccurate, incomplete, obscure or dated, is entitled to request the owner of the database to revise the information or delete it. If the owner of the database declines, it must notify the applicant of same in the manner set out in the regulations. A decision of a database owner not to allow inspection of information stored therein or a decision rejecting an application to amend or delete information, may be appealed by the person making the request in the manner set out in the regulations.
